Benny is being developed as a Mobility & Support Service Dog with a parallel clinical AAI capability track. His 24-month program integrates health testing, structured obedience, public access training, and task-specific clinical behaviors.

Veteran & Moral Injury
MIIRP + AAI Integration
AAI is uniquely positioned for moral injury treatment. The dog reduces the shame barrier, enables truth-telling without immediate judgment, and provides a witness presence during narrative reconstruction — core elements of the MIIRP model.

Michael Spayde brings 16 years of working dog expertise to his MSW clinical training, combining deep practical knowledge of service dog development with advanced trauma-informed behavioral health practice. His work integrates the human-animal bond as a structured clinical tool — not a supplement, but a primary therapeutic mechanism.
As a Senior Professional in Human Resources (SPHR) and MSW student at Spring Arbor University, Michael is developing a comprehensive Animal-Assisted Intervention framework targeting veteran populations experiencing PTSD, moral injury, and TBI-related behavioral health needs. His Cane Corso, Benny, is currently in the foundation phase of a 24-month service dog development program.
